"Situated in this extremely convenient location being only a short walk of Hadleigh Town Centre with its array of shopping and eating facilities is this attractive two bedroom semi detached cottage benefitting from a lounge, separate dining room, kitchen with separate utility area, shower room and a lean to/conservatory to the ground floor and two good size bedrooms to the first floor. The property also benefits from having a good size south backing rear garden with good size side access and off street parking to the front and as the owners sole agents we would advise any interested parties to view at their earliest convenience to avoid disappointment.

Accommodation Comprises:
Side entrance door leading to:
Entrance Hall: which is carpeted, under stairs storage cupboard, high level meters, doors to accommodation off.
Lounge 13'6 x 12'2 (4.11m x 3.71m): with double glazed square bay Georgian window to front aspect, fitted carpet, radiator, power points, television point, dado rail, picture rail, feature cast iron fire place, smooth plastered and coved ceiling with embossed centre rose.
Dining Room 12'2 x 11'2 (3.71m x 3.4m): with double glazed Georgian window to side aspect, fitted carpet, radiator, power points, under stairs storage cupboard, picture rail, feature tiled fire place with wooden mantle, smooth plastered and coved ceiling with embossed centre rose, door leading to stairs to first floor accommodation, further door leading to:
Kitchen 12'3 x 5'4 (3.73m x 1.63m): with double glazed window to side aspect. The kitchen is fitted to include a modern stainless steel circular single drainer with separate bowl unit with swan neck mixer tap inset into a range of roll edge work surfaces continuing to the most expanse of three walls with a range of cupboards and drawers beneath, inset space for cooker, under unit space for dishwasher, range of matching eye level wall mounted units with central extractor fan, half tiled to all walls, tiled flooring, radiator, power points, smooth plastered and coved ceiling with inset spot lights, door leading to:
Utility Area: with continuation of the tiled flooring, appliance space and plumbing for washing machine, freestanding space for fridge/freezer, wall mounted Worcester boiler (not checked), wall mounted thermostat control, high level storage cupboard, half tiled to walls, folding door to shower room, barn style door leading to:
Conservatory/Lean To: which is double glazed to three aspects, tiled flooring, double glazed door to rear opening to and overlooking the rear garden
Shower Room/w.c: with double glazed obscure window to rear aspect, a three piece suite comprising of a fully tiled corner shower unit with sliding screen doors, corner wall mounted wash hand basin and a triple push button w.c, fully tiled to three walls, stainless steel heated towel rail, continuation of the tiled flooring, textured and coved ceiling.
First Floor Accommodation: which is carpeted, double glazed window to side aspect, wood panelling to walls, doors to accommodation off.
Bedroom One 12'5 x 11'4 (3.78m x 3.45m): with double glazed Georgian window to side aspect, radiator, fitted carpet, power points, feature fire place. storage cupboard, picture rail, smooth plastered ceiling with embossed centre rose, wood panelling to one wall.
Bedroom Two 12'2 x 11'1 (3.71m x 3.38m): with double glazed Georgian window to front aspect, radiator, fitted carpet, power points, television point, feature fire place, storage cupboard, access to loft.
Outside: the property benefits from a good size south backing rear garden with a paved patio area to the immediate rear with step up leading to a further side paved patio area, the remainder of the garden is mainly laid to lawn with a range of flower, shrub, hedge and tree borders including plum and apple trees. To the extreme rear of the property there is a further paved patio area with trellis and two established wooden sheds. To the side of the property there is a further paved patio area with exterior water tap and double wooden gates leading to:
Front Garden: which is approached via lich style arch top and is paved to proved off street parking for one vehicle with a further side shingle area and retaining brick wall.
